  • Patent number: 5836550
    Abstract: The invention is a mechanism for the streamwise deployment of an aircraft trailing or leading edge flap. The mechanism connects the spar and flap. There are a pair of swivel links which pivotally connect the spar to the flap. There are also a pair of slaving mechanisms which rotationally connect the spar to the flap by spherical bearings. A linear flap actuator initiates the combined pivotal and rotational action from the spar which translates into a single downward and rearward motion of the flap.

  • Patent number: 5753523
    Abstract: Organic films are applied from solvent solution to a substrate, then are ion implanted to have resistivity in the kilohm/square to gigaohm/square range. The films are then patterned by standard lithographic procedures, with surprisingly little loss of conductivity, in spite of contact with organic solvents or acidic or basic etchant solutions during the patterning process. Both structures which contact the substrate, and freestanding conductive polymer bridges, can be formed. The invention provides a method of producing electrical devices which does not require the use of single crystal semiconductor substrates or deposition of inorganic semiconductors. The resulting devices are highly resistant to damage from abrasion, solvents, acids, bases, and moisture.

  • Patent number: 5660886
    Abstract: An improved protective coating system for metal substrates is described. Nickel-aluminide duplex coatings are improved by adding an effective amount of boron in the nickel coating step and by retaining the boron during the aluminization step. An unexpected result of the retained boron is its non-deleterious effect on oxidation protection. During aluminization, the boron surprisingly migrates to the coating/substrate interface, forming a diffusion barrier in situ. The barrier inhibits both inward diffusion of the nickel-aluminide coating and outward diffusion of substrate impurities. The process enables thinner, less expensive coatings.

  • Patent number: 5614150
    Abstract: A method for producing aluminum matrix composites containing refractory aluminide whiskers or particulates which are formed in-situ is disclosed. Aluminum and refractory metal materials are blended in powder form and then heated to a temperature above the melting point of aluminum. A solid/liquid reaction between the molten aluminum and solid refractory metal provides a desired volume fraction of refractory aluminide reinforcement phase (in situ whiskers or particulates). Upon cooling the molten, unreacted portion of aluminum solidifies around the in situ reinforcements to create the improved composite material.

  • Patent number: 5578676
    Abstract: A composition and a method for forming an anti-reflective layer for DUV microlithographic processes is disclosed. The compositions of the present invention includes a polymer dissolved in a suitable solvent. The polymers are polysulfone and polyurea polymers which possess inherent light absorbing properties at deep ultraviolet wavelengths. In accordance with the method of the present invention, these compositions are applied to a substrate to form an anti-reflective coating, and thereafter a photoresist material that is compatible with the anti-reflective coating is applied.

  • Patent number: 5427763
    Abstract: A method for making vanadium dioxide (V.sub.2 or V.sub.2 O.sub.4) powders from vanadyl sulfate without using SO.sub.2 gas, comprises evaporative decomposition of a vanadyl sulfate hydrate spray, entrained in a nitrogen atmosphere at O.sub.2 partial pressures that would normally predict V.sub.2 O.sub.5 V.sub.2 O.sub.3. The yield of VO.sub.2 (also identified as V.sub.2 O.sub.4) is substantially improved, and occurs at lower temperatures, by the addition of hydrogen gas into the atmosphere. Surprisingly, there is no production of V.sub.2 O.sub.3. Minor amounts of a suitable dopant salt dissolved in the spray provide improved low transition temperature powders.
